Market note
Pre-order
T7 Smart Bike is stored as a pre-order product. It is not presented as normally available; confirm regional shipping, warranty and final software support before ordering.

Mini Watt compatibility
Will it work with Mini Watt?
Regional technical documentation lists Bluetooth FTMS, so Mini Watt support is likely once hardware ships. Product remains pre-order.
